Answer by PvG for How to get primary key columns in pd.DataFrame.to_sql...
You can do something like this with SQLalchemy:from sqlalchemy import MetaDatafrom sqlalchemy.dialects.postgresql import insertimport psycopg2import sqlalchemydef upsert_data(df, url, schema, table,...
View ArticleHow to get primary key columns in pd.DataFrame.to_sql insertion method for...
I'm trying to modify pandas insertion method using COPY. The purpose is to implement an "upsert" mechanism for Postgres database.I'm using this SO answer for creating temp table and copying data into...
View Article